EGGNOG SUGAR COOKIES
Ingredients: 2 1/2 cups flour
1 tsp baking powder
1/2 tsp ground cinnamon
1/2 tsp ground nutmeg
1 1/4 cups granulated sugar
3/4 cup butter, at room temperature
1/2 cup eggnog
1 1/2 tsp vanilla
2 egg yolks
Preparation: 1. Preheat oven to 300 degrees
2. Mix flour, baking powder, cinnamon and nutmeg in a bowl. Set aside
3. In another bowl, mix sugar and butter until creamed. Add eggnog, vanilla and egg yolks, mix until smooth.
4. Add dry ingredients to creamed ingredients and mix until moist.
5. Place rounded teaspoons of cookie dough onto baking sheet about 2 inches apart. Sprinkle with nutmeg.
6. Bake for 20 minutes or until bottoms are lightly browned.
7. Remove from baking sheet and let cool. Makes 3 dozen.
